About Annamaria Mazzia
Annamaria Mazzia is a scholar working on Numerical Analysis, Computational Mechanics and Mechanics of Materials, having authored 32 papers that have together received 415 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Numerical Methods in Computational Mathematics (18 papers), Numerical methods in engineering (14 papers) and Electromagnetic Simulation and Numerical Methods (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Numerical Analysis (58 citations), Environmental Engineering (125 citations) and Computational Mechanics (169 citations). Annamaria Mazzia has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and Argentina. Frequent co-authors include Mario Putti, Giorgio Pini, Flavio Sartoretto, Luca Bergamaschi, Claudio Paniconi, Sylvain Weill, Massimiliano Ferronato, Giuseppe Gambolati, Gianmarco Manzini and Francesca Mazzia.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Computational Physics, International Journal for Numerical Methods in Engineering and Hydrology and earth system sciences.
